What is a UAV contractor?

UAV contractors are professionals or companies who provide services related to un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), also known as drones. Their work can include aerial photography, surveying, mapping, inspection, surveillance, delivery, or agricultural monitoring, depending on the client's needs. UAV contractors are responsible for operating drones safely and legally, often holding certifications and complying with aviation regulations. They may work on a contract basis for industries like construction, real estate, energy, and public safety. The role typically requires technical skills in drone operation, data processing, and sometimes drone maintenance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a UAV contractor?

To thrive as a UAV Contractor, you need expertise in drone operation, flight planning, and knowledge of aviation regulations, often supported by a Part 107 Remote Pilot Certificate or equivalent licensure. Familiarity with flight control software, mapping tools, and maintenance systems is essential for efficient and safe operations.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you adapt to dynamic environments and meet client needs. These skills and qualifications are crucial to ensure regulatory compliance, operational safety, and the successful delivery of UAV-related services.

What is the difference between Uav Contractor vs Uav Pilot?

AspectUav ContractorUav Pilot
CredentialsFAA Part 107 certification, relevant drone operation experienceFAA Part 107 certification, drone flying experience
Work EnvironmentContract-based projects, client sites, remote locationsOperational flying, on-site or remote locations
Employer/Industry UsageContracting companies, government agencies, private firmsDrone service providers, media, agriculture, inspection

Uav Contractors typically manage multiple projects and coordinate drone operations for clients, often working as independent contractors or with firms. Uav Pilots focus on flying drones, executing specific missions. While both roles require FAA Part 107 certification and drone operation skills, Contractors often oversee project logistics, whereas Pilots concentrate on flight execution.

JOB TITLE: UAV PILOT II-III
DEPARTMENT: FLIGHT OPERATIONS
REPORTS TO: DEPLOYMENT SITE LEAD
EMPLOYMENT TYPE: FULL-TIME OR CONTRACT
TRAVEL REQUIRED: 100% OCONUS
CLEARANCE TYPE: SECRET

This position may be filled as a full-time employee or 1099 Contractor depending on business needs and candidate fit.

Job Summary

Under minimal supervision, supports the ground and flight operations of an Unmanned Aircraft System during stateside and overseas operations. Responsible for the safe operation of the aircraft and the success of mission objectives, the pilot will be a cross-functional member of a two-man team, functioning as either the Pilot-in-Command or Flight Engineer.

Duties/Responsibilities
  • Perform flight operation planning in support of customer-driven requirements.
  • Perform pre-flight, in-flight, and post-flight safety checks.
  • Remote pilot a UAS, following a specific flight plan or modifying flight plans to meet mission objectives.
  • Assist flight operation planning in support of customer-driven requirements.
  • Support flight operations outside the continental United States for up to six (6) months at a time, or as mutually agreed upon.
  • Conduct flight demonstrations for customers at remote locations.
  • Assist team with furthering and refining training curriculum, documentation, and standardization materials.
  • Troubleshoot equipment issues to maximize mission readiness rates.
  • Ensure compliance with all FAA, host nation, and customer regulations as applicable.
  • Perform other duties as necessary.
Basic Requirements - Level II
  • High school diploma or GED certificate.
  • 2-5 years of relevant experience.
  • Minimum of 500 hours of flight experience as a Pilot in Command.
  • Must currently possess and maintain a DoD Secret level security clearance.
  • Must have ability to obtain and maintain a DoD Top Secret level security clearance.
  • Able to obtain FAA Class II Medical Certificate.
  • Up to 100% CONUS and OCONUS travel may be required.
  • Position is contingent on the ability to pass required flight and deployment physicals.
  • Expert knowledge and extensive experience with Piccolo or Quattro flight controllers.
Basic Requirements - Level III
  • High school diploma or GED certificate.
  • 5-7 years of relevant experience.
  • Minimum of 500 hours of flight experience as a Pilot in Command.
  • Must currently possess and maintain a DoD Secret level security clearance.
  • Must have ability to obtain and maintain a DoD Top Secret level security clearance.
  • Able to obtain FAA Class II Medical Certificate.
  • Completion of training or a degree in aviation, engineering, or a related field preferred.
  • Up to 100% CONUS and OCONUS travel may be required.
  • Position is contingent on the ability to pass required flight and deployment physicals.
  • Expert knowledge and extensive experience with Piccolo or Quattro flight controllers.
Preferred Requirements
  • Completion of training or a degree in aviation, engineering, or a related field.
  • Military flight experience is highly desirable.
  • Part 107 Remote Pilot Certificate.
  • Private Pilot License.
  • Experience in deployed UAS ISR operations.
